Community Briefs

Published December 2, 2008, 9:28 pm, Asheville Citizen-Times

ASHEVILLE – Asheville Parks and Recreation's Senior Treks program, a low-impact trekking club, will travel to the Grassy Mount Carl Sandburg trails on Dec. 12. The trek will be an easy, four-mile walk through the grounds of the Carl Sandburg Home. The day doesn't involve visiting the inside of the home, just the grounds.

Business Tri-State: Effort would make St. Louis clean coal focal point

Published December 2, 2008, 9:16 pm, The Huntington Herald-Dispatch

ST. LOUIS -- Two major coal companies and one of the Midwest's largest utilities are combining with Washington University to try and make St. Louis the nation's center for clean coal research and education.

Taupo decision not to be appealed

Published December 2, 2008, 8:07 pm, Scoop.co.nz

Federated Farmers has confirmed it will not be lodging an appeal in the High Court challenging the recent Environment Court decision on Environment Waikato's ''Lake Taupo Variation'', Variation 5 to the Waikato Regional Plan.
